zoukankan      html  css  js  c++  java
  • python3运算符:类型、运算符的优先级

    一、Python算术运算符

     

    二、Python比较运算符

    以下假设变量a为10,变量b为20:

     

     

    三、Python赋值运算符

     

    四、Python位运算符

    按位运算符是把数字看作二进制来进行计算的。Python中的按位运算法则如下:

    下表中变量 a 为 60,b 为 13二进制格式如下:

     

    五、Python逻辑运算符

     

    六、Python成员运算符

    Python还支持成员运算符,包括字符串,列表或元组。

     

     

    七、Python身份运算符

    身份运算符用于比较两个对象的存储单元

    注: id() 函数用于获取对象内存地址。

    is 与 == 区别:is 用于判断两个变量引用对象是否为同一个, == 用于判断引用变量的值是否相等。

     

    八、Python运算符优先级

    以下表格列出了从最高到最低优先级的所有运算符:

    注意:Pyhton3 已不支持 <> 运算符,可以使用 != 代替,如果你一定要使用这种比较运算符,可以使用以下的方式:

    >>> from __future__ import barry_as_FLUFL
    >>> 1 <> 2
    True
  • 相关阅读:
    费马定理
    JAVA大数模板
    扩展KMP模板
    KMP算法模板
    2018暑假遗留题目
    线段树模板(含区间最大(小)值)
    [USACO18OPEN]Out of Sorts G
    几道背包题
    两个有关素数的算法
    German Collegiate Programming Contest 2015 F. Divisions
  • 原文地址:https://www.cnblogs.com/zhanym/p/15750073.html
Copyright © 2011-2022 走看看